Zcash utilizes the Equihash proof-of-work (PoW) algorithm, which is designed to be ASIC resistant, thus making it easier for individuals with ordinary computers to mine Zcash. Zcash enables users to send and receive pay with complete privacy using zk-SNARKs technology which masks all transactions. Thus, owing to the mining and privacy features Zcash has proved popular among some of most privacy seeking electronic currency enthusiasts.

Selecting the appropriate hardware
As already mentioned in the introduction, finding suitable hardware is essential to the efficient mine of Zcash. Despite the fact that extracting of Zcash should be possible utilizing computer processors, it is more useful and productive to utilize GPU extracting. Examples of these popular options include the AMD Radeon RX 5700 XT, the N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3060, and the RTX 3070. As these parts will have direct effect on your benefit from mining, it is important to also consider hash rate and power and cooling parameters in selecting your extracting equipment.
Creating an account on Zcash
You must have a wallet in order to save your Zcash rewards before you can start mining. Available on the Zcash website, the official Zcash wallet accepts both transparent (public) and shielded (private) addresses. Third-party wallets, like as Zecwallet or YWallet, which provide user-friendly interfaces and extra functions, are also an option. To safeguard your money, build a new wallet after installing your old one and be sure to safely save your recovery phrase.
Selecting mining software
After your wallet and hardware are prepared, you must choose the appropriate Zcash extracting software. Popular choices for people who want to rent out their hashing power include Claymore’s ZCash Miner, EWBF’s Cuda Zcash Miner for NVIDIA GPUs, and NiceHash. By using these extracting apps, you may begin mining by connecting your extracting equipment to the Zcash network. Downloading the mining software from reliable or approved sources will guarantee security.
Selecting a mining pool or solo mining
Zcash may be mined individually or in an extracting pool. Solo extracting requires a strong setup, a substantial financial outlay, and since extracting is competitive, payments may be erratic. Extracting pools, on the other hand, enable miners to pool their resources, improving the likelihood of receiving steady payouts. Zpool, Flypool, and F2Pool are well-known Zcash extracting pools. A mining pool’s total hash rate, payment plans, and pool fees are all important considerations.
Configuring your mining software
Once you’ve picked an extracting pool, set up your mining program to interface with it. Typically, this procedure is providing the server URL for the mining pool and submitting your wallet address. The majority of extracting software will assist you with this process by offering comprehensive setup instructions or tutorials. Make sure that any extra parameters, such the number of threads or power settings, are configured according to the capability of your machine.
Start your mining operation
You may begin mining when everything has been setup and set up. Your hardware and the mining pool will be connected as soon as your mining software is launched. Check your hash rate, temperature, and general performance by keeping an eye on the program. You may monitor your revenue and system health using Zcash extracting software, which usually offers real-time information.
Monitoring and optimizing performance
Pay attention to the performance indicators of your miner in order to optimize your mining profitability. Utilize monitoring tools to keep tabs on your hardware’s power usage and temperature. Make sure your miner is running within safe temperature ranges to prevent harm from overheating. To maximize performance, you may also adjust the parameters of your extracting program according to your hardware and power supply.
Managing your profits
Your extracting pool account will get Zcash rewards once you begin earning them, which you may then withdraw to your Zcash wallet. Transferring your profits on a regular basis will protect them against changes in the exchange platform or mining pool. Protecting your profits requires regular wallet backups and safekeeping of your private keys.
